xen-devel.lists.xenproject.org archive mirror
 help / color / mirror / Atom feed
* Initial Mini-OS port to ARM64
@ 2014-02-16 15:51 Chen Baozi
  2014-02-16 20:44 ` Julien Grall
  2014-02-18 15:54 ` Ian Campbell
  0 siblings, 2 replies; 8+ messages in thread
From: Chen Baozi @ 2014-02-16 15:51 UTC (permalink / raw)
  To: List Developer Xen; +Cc: Ian Campbell, Samuel Thibault

Hi all,

It is much later than I used to expect. I guess it might be help
to publish my work, though it is still not finished (and might not
be finished very soon...). 

I began to try to port mini-os to ARM64 since last summer. Since
the 64-bit guest support is not quite well at that time, this
work had been stopped for a long time until two months ago.

Though it is still at very early stage, it at least can be built,
setup a early page table for booting, parse the DTB passed by the
hypervisor, and be debugged by printk at present. So I put it
on github in case someone might be interested in it. Here is the
url: https://github.com/baozich/minios-arm64

Right now, there are some troubles to make GIC work properly,
as I didn’t consider mapping GIC’s interface in address space and
follows x86’s memory layout which make the kernel virtual address
starts at 0x0. I’ll fix it as soon as possible.

Besides, there is still lots of work to be done. So any comments
or patches are welcome.

Regards,

Baozi

^ permalink raw reply	[flat|nested] 8+ messages in thread

end of thread, other threads:[~2014-02-24 15:49 UTC | newest]

Thread overview: 8+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2014-02-16 15:51 Initial Mini-OS port to ARM64 Chen Baozi
2014-02-16 20:44 ` Julien Grall
2014-02-24 14:30   ` Julien Grall
     [not found]   ` <CAOTdubvBf9Ce=MZJQs639sOt+718CsgDv2D+oO1_B7XXu+SgGw@mail.gmail.com>
2014-02-24 15:49     ` Julien Grall
2014-02-18 15:54 ` Ian Campbell
2014-02-23 14:41   ` Chen Baozi
2014-02-24  1:35     ` Chen Baozi
2014-02-24 11:27     ` Ian Campbell

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).